Output 7626d51658a8d89b5e781a14ea04c7bda40ce1829955edf0642c27b03bedcca9:56

value
68772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14e0d809c24cb0154cd4059f071b4b7e3c381edf OP_EQUAL
address
33bQnoqW7NEkiGBSyrgcPvTyCBkDNbApQ8
transaction
7626d51658a8d89b5e781a14ea04c7bda40ce1829955edf0642c27b03bedcca9
spent
true